What the Tour Is All About

This three-hour adventure takes you along Mallorca’s northern coast, a stretch famed for its clear waters and spectacular cliffs. It’s hosted by The Challenge Mallorca, a provider known for organizing lively, well-structured experiences. You’ll start with pickup from several locations in the north, including Alcúdia, Puerto Alcúdia, Playa de Muro, and Can Picafort, making it accessible without the hassle of arranging your own transport.

Once you arrive and meet your guides, the excitement begins. The guides are friendly, speak multiple languages (English, Spanish, French, Catalan), and are attentive to safety. They organize the activities smoothly, ensuring everyone feels comfortable and prepared.

The Itinerary Breakdown

1. Pickup and Transfer
The tour begins with an optional pickup from your accommodation or designated meeting points, with pickups starting 20 to 50 minutes before the scheduled start. This flexibility is helpful, especially if you’re staying outside Alcúdia.

2. Guided Coastal Tour (2.5 hours)
After arriving at the meeting point near Alcúdia, you’ll go on a guided tour along Mallorca’s beautiful northern coast. This part is as much about soaking in the scenery as it is about starting the adventure. The guides point out interesting spots and ensure the group stays together.

3. Kayaking (30 minutes)
Paddling along the coast, you’ll get a chance to admire the coastline’s rugged beauty from the water. The kayaks are described as stable and comfortable, suitable even for those with limited experience. Reviews mention that the activity is very doable for beginners, which is great if you’re concerned about inexperience.

4. Cave Exploration and Treasure Hunt
The highlight for many is exploring a marine sea cave. The guides lead you inside, where natural rock formations and clear waters create a magical atmosphere. One reviewer described it as feeling like “a scene from the Goonies,” which is pretty spot-on. Inside, you’ll search for the key that unlocks the sunken treasure, adding a fun, game-like element to the exploration.

5. Cliff Jumping (Optional)
The next stop takes you to a cliff jumping spot, which can be skipped if you’re not feeling brave or comfortable. If you do jump, the guides are encouraging, and the views from above are spectacular. It’s a brief but adrenaline-pumping moment that adds a thrill to your day.

6. Snorkeling & Sunken Treasure
After the jumps, you’ll snorkel in the clear waters, searching for the treasure. The water is described as pristine, and the experience is accessible even to those who aren’t expert swimmers. The guides provide snorkeling gear and make sure everyone is safe and comfortable.

7. Picnic & Relaxation
The tour wraps up with a picnic on the beach, featuring camping-style snacks and drinks. It’s a nice way to unwind and share stories about what you’ve seen and done. Keep in mind that reviews suggest you should be quick at the picnic if you want to enjoy the snacks, as they tend to run out fast.

Practical Considerations

While the tour is very inclusive, there are a few things to keep in mind. You should be able to move around easily and be comfortable in water, though swimming skills are not mandatory. The tour isn’t suitable for children under five or people with mobility issues, and participants over 110kg might find kayaking difficult due to weight limits.

You’ll need to bring swimwear, a towel, sunscreen, and water. Valuables and large bags aren’t allowed, so keep your belongings minimal. The tour lasts about three hours, making it perfect for a half-day trip when combined with other activities or relaxation.

FAQs

Mallorca: Kayaking, Sea Cave, Cliff Jumping & Snorkel Tour - FAQs

Is the tour suitable for non-swimmers?
Yes, the tour is doable for non-swimmers because the activities involve equipment like life jackets, wetsuits, and snorkeling gear. However, you should be comfortable moving around in water and willing to wear the gear.

How long does the tour last?
The adventure lasts about 3 hours, with specific starting times available—you’ll want to check the schedule to plan your day accordingly.

Are the activities optional?
Cliff jumping is optional; if you’re not comfortable, you can skip it. All other activities like kayaking, cave exploring, and snorkeling are part of the experience but can be enjoyed at your own pace.

What is included in the price?
The cost covers guides speaking multiple languages, all gear (wetsuit, kayak, helmet, life jacket, water shoes, snorkeling equipment), a picnic lunch, photos and videos, and transport in the north of Mallorca.

Is transportation provided?
Yes, pickup and transfer from several locations in Mallorca are included. You’ll receive an email with your pickup time based on your chosen location.

Can I join if I don’t have my own transportation?
Absolutely. The tour offers an optional pickup service, making it easy to join without worrying about logistics.

What should I bring?
Bring swimwear, a towel, sunscreen, and water. Leave valuables and large bags behind since they are not allowed on the tour.

Is there a weight limit for participants?
Yes, participants over 110kg might find kayaking difficult due to the kayak’s weight limitations.
